Steps to Renew NY Driver’s License

Renewing your driver’s license is probably the most common type of license renewal in New York. Here’s how you can do it:

Step 1: Check Your Eligibility

Not everyone can renew their driver’s license online. Factors such as traffic violations, unpaid tickets, or certain medical conditions might require you to renew in person. Make sure you meet the eligibility criteria before attempting an online renewal.

Step 2: Gather Required Documents

Just like we mentioned earlier, you’ll need your current license, proof of identity, and proof of residency. Double-check that all your documents are up to date and legible.

Step 3: Pay the Renewal Fee

The renewal fee for a standard driver’s license in New York is around $25, but this can vary depending on the type of license and additional endorsements. Be sure to confirm the exact fee before proceeding.

Important Deadlines for License Renewal

Missing a renewal deadline can lead to serious consequences, including fines, suspension, or even revocation of your license. Here’s a quick overview of important deadlines:

  • Driver’s licenses: Typically need to be renewed every four years
  • Professional licenses: Vary by profession, but most require renewal every two to three years
